It's been awhile since we've heard new music from Tyga mostly due to label issues. But earlier this year he signed to G.O.O.D Music, and now he's got a new single to start of the new year.

Tyga's new track features the label's founder and his girlfriend's brother-in-law Kanye West. The song is very similar to the previous projects Tyga's released with a catchy beat under his distinct voice rapping about money, and his lifestyle. T-Raww also refers his lover throughout the song.

"Kylie Jenner thick, you gotta feel me/ 'Happy birthday, here's a Benz', feel me?/ First, last name rich, feel me?/ Yeah, bitch, I'm the s---, feel me?" Tyga raps on the hook.

Though the song sounds true to Tyga and what he's done, it also has a Kanye twist on it that you can here from beginning to end. The instrumental also gives ScHoolboy Q "That Part" vibes (that Kanye also featured on in 2016) with a scary movie theme song organ over it.

'Ye couldn't go the whole song without mentioned his wife as well.

"Kim K thick, you gotta feel me/ At the dealership like what's the dealy?/ Usher Raymond chain, it's too chilly!/ Usher Raymond chain, it's too chilly!"

The song will likely appear on the rapper's upcoming GOOD Music debut, but there's been no confirmation as to when that project will release.
